Weekend Spectator Tickets

Starting mid-afternoon Saturday and all-day Sunday the Paddock Display will feature cars and motorbikes from various eras
The Paddock Display area will be a focal point for the whole event and we expect to see a large number of visitors wanting to view and learn more about the vehicles on display. A number of car clubs are expected to attend to add to the spectacle
In addition to our event sponsor stands we expect to have a variety of trade stands and other specialists displaying their products and services
A large video screen will be installed to enable visitors to enjoy owner interviews and the paddock display vehicles
Attendees will be able to enjoy the on-site music and entertainment and access the food village at the main festival site on Saturday evening and throughout the event
Sunday 27th July
Non-Competitive Hill Climb / Paddock Display / Food & Drink Village / Trade & Car Club Stands
Sunday will be the main day of our event and in addition to the items described for Saturday our centrepiece will be a non-competitive, non-timed Hill Climb for road registered vehicles on a closed road course of about one mile in length that will commence from adjacent to the main festival site and paddock
Here there will be viewing platforms for the public to enjoy the start and a large video screen will be installed to enable the public and other entrants to watch the vehicles as they progress up the hill
There will be no spectator access to the closed road section during the event
We expect cars and motorcycle to enjoy at least one morning and afternoon run up the Hill Climb
